Miami is the major city situated on the Atlantic coast in sunny southeastern Florida. Miami is the county seat of Miami-Dade County, which is one of the most populous county in Florida. It is the main city and the center of the South Florida metropolitan area, which as of 2008 had a population of 5,414,712. This makes Miami the 7th largest city in the U.S.A. The Miami Area was the fifth most populous urbanized area in the U.S. in the 2000 census with a population of 4,919,036.6 In 2008, the population of the Miami urbanized area had increased to 5,232,342, becoming the fourth-largest urbanized area in the United States, behind New York City, Los Angeles, and Chicago.
Miami is a well-known worldwide city due to its importance in finance, mercantilism, culture, media, style, education, film, print media, entertainment, the arts and international trade. Known as The Gateway to the Americas, Miami is the international center for entertainment, education, media, music, fashion, film, culture, print media, and the performing arts.
The city’s business district is home to the largest concentration of international banks in the United States as well as home to several corporate home office and television studios. Additionally, the metropolis’ namesake port, the Port of Miami, is the busiest cruise ship passenger port in the world.
Miami and its metropolitan area grew from just over one thousand residents to nearly five and a half million residents in just 110 years (1896–2006). The city’s nickname, The Magic City, comes from this rapid growth. Winter visitors remarked that the city grew so much from one year to the next that it was like magic.
Miami has a tropical monsoon climate (Köppen climate classification Am)34 with hot and humid summers and short, warm winters, with a marked drier season in the winter. Its sea-level elevation, coastal location, position just above the Tropic of Cancer, and proximity to the Gulf Stream shapes its climate.
